How valuable is ActionCOACH business coaching to a business owner?

That question was recently posed as part of a recent independent study on the value and effectiveness of business coaching conducted by the UK-based Cogent Research.

The Cogent research study comes on the heels of a recent U.S.-based study of companies coached by ActionCOACH in South Florida. That study showed that despite the recession, coached companies had grown revenues by more than $12 million. The research study also revealed coached businesses saw a return on investment (ROI) of 7.5-to-1, or $7.50 in return for every $1 invested in coaching.

In the UK, Cogent found the following statistics:

• 74% of ActionCOACH coached businesses increased sales last year compared to only 43% of non-coached businesses
• 30% average annual sales growth in ActionCOACH coached businesses compared to only 13% in non-coached businesses
• 82% of ActionCOACH coached businesses are confident of sales growth in the next 12 months compared to only 55% of non-coached businesses
• 53% of ActionCOACH coached businesses increased profits last year compared to only 35% of non-coached businesses
• 77% of ActionCOACH coached businesses forecast growth in profit in next 12 months
• 30% of ActionCOACH coached businesses increased their profits in the last 12 months by more than £50,000
• 56% of ActionCOACH coached businesses increased their workforce compared to only 14% of non-coached businesses
• 91% of ActionCOACH coached businesses have a plan for the next quarter compared to only 37% in non-coached businesses
• 97% of coached businesses would recommend coaching to other SME’s (small and medium enterprises)

Cogent also noted that:

“Businesses generally who had adopted formalised procedures such as those recommended by ActionCOACH (e.g. workflow procedures, twelve month budgets, written business plans, KPI’s) appeared to not only have weathered the adverse trading conditions of the previous twelve months but have actually increased sales, profits and workforce.”

If you’re wondering if your business idea is truly viable, here’s some things to consider …

Will you be selling something people really want to buy … or something you really want to sell?

Is there enough current demand for the type of product or service you’re looking to sell?

Do you know all of your numbers?

Here’s some additional advice and counsel from ActionCOACH Founder and Chairman Brad Sugars, about this very topic:

What should you consider before opening a business?

Remember, it’s better to ask and get your questions answered BEFORE you start your company … you’ll be a lot better off knowing if your idea is truly viable at the start, rather than finding out (too late) that it might not be, or that the numbers don’t work.
